今天在做数据导入时,发现有几个异常分区。因为异常分区影响到BI端数据报表展示。所以需要删除;
当执行删除分区命令是一直报如下错误
无法删除分区,然后就使用hdfs dfs -rm -rf /命令删除分区后,使用msck修复后,分区并未删掉。 最后查看分区字段类型时,发现dt是date类型;
ALTER TABLE smart.smart_company_dws PARTITION COLUMN (dt string);
改成string类型后操作成功;
本文分享自 作者个人站点/博客 前往查看
如有侵权,请联系 cloudcommunity@tencent.com 删除。
本文参与 腾讯云自媒体同步曝光计划 ,欢迎热爱写作的你一起参与!